The West Memphis Three Freed

The West Memphis Three, namely Damien Echols, Jason Baldwin and Jessie Misskelley, Jr., are now freed after 18 years of imprisonment.


The West Memphis ‘Three’ was imprisoned in 1994 after convicted of murdering three 8-year-old boys.

However, lately, new evidence has proven them not guilty from doing such act. Perhaps the reason why they are being freed.

Image lifted from Los Angeles Times.


